Cardiac Markers Combo(cTnl/Myo/CK-MB) Rapid Test
Catalog No.: BGW1501C

INTRODUCTION

The Cardiac Markers Combo Rapid Test Device (Whole Blood/Serum/Plasma) is a rapid visual immunoassay for the qualitative presumptive detection of human Myoglobin, CKMB and cardiac Troponin I in whole blood, serum or plasma. This kit is intended for use as an aid in the diagnosis of myocardial infarction (MI).

INTERPRETATION OF RESULTS

Negative: Only one colored band appears on the control (C) region. No apparent band on the test (T) region. 
Positive: in addition to a pink colored control (C) band, a distinct pink colored band will also appear in the test (T) region. Invalid: A total absence of color in both regions is an indication of procedure error and/or the test reagent has deteriorated.
